Why My Timestamp didnt work on DB Connect?

We set up an input in DbConnect and it works perfectly in our development environment but when we apply the same input to the production server it is not being able to load the data.

Follow below our query:
select DATEDIFF(SECOND, '1970-01-01', Data_inicio_cadastro) as Timestamp,
*
from vw_SplunkBaseClientes;

in data format parameters we configured yyyy-MM-dd HH:mm:ss but in production we are getting the following error message:
2018-06-08 21:18:03.133 -0300 INFO c.s.dbx.server.task.listeners.JobMetricsListener - action=collect_job_metrics connection=AGLPNHPSQL09-PineOnline jdbc_url=null db_read_time=37 record_read_error_count=5312 status=COMPLETED input_name=PineOnlineBaseCliente batch_size=1000 error_threshold=N/A is_jmx_monitoring=false start_time=2018-06-08_09:18:02 end_time=2018-06-08_09:18:03 duration=396 read_count=5312 write_count=0 filtered_count=0 error_count=5312

You are selecting the number of seconds since Jan 1, 1970 as "Timestamp", why should you need to configure the date format parameters as "yyyy-MM-dd HH:mm:ss"?

Also, obviously make a backup of the production stuff before hand, but did you reconfigure production to match your dev environment, or did you just copy the related configuration files over? Because you can pretty much just do the latter....
